What is a 90 Degree Elbow?
A 90-degree elbow is a type of pipe fitting that allows for a change in direction of flow. Specifically, it directs the flow at a right angle, which is essential in various piping layouts. This fitting is commonly used in both residential and industrial plumbing, HVAC systems, and various mechanical applications. The ability to change direction reduces the need for straight pipe runs and is crucial for navigating obstacles within a piping system.
The Role of Stainless Steel
Stainless steel is a widely used material in the manufacturing of pipe fittings due to its unique properties. It is known for its corrosion resistance, strength, durability, and aesthetic appeal. The 4% stainless steel typically refers to the amount of alloying elements such as chromium, nickel, or molybdenum in the steel, which contribute to its overall performance. For instance, stainless steel that contains approximately 4% molybdenum is often referred to as a high-grade steel, which exhibits excellent resistance to pitting and crevice corrosion, especially in chloride environments.
Applications of 4% Stainless Steel 90 Degree Elbows
1. Industrial Piping Systems In various industries such as chemical processing, food and beverage manufacturing, and pharmaceuticals, stainless steel piping systems are essential. The 90-degree elbow allows for efficient routing of fluids or gases, accommodating the complex layouts required in industrial settings.
2. Water Treatment Facilities Water treatment systems often employ 90-degree elbows made from stainless steel to manage the flow of water, protect against corrosion from chlorides and other chemicals, and ensure a long-lasting installation.
3. HVAC Systems In heating, ventilation, and air conditioning systems, stainless steel elbows assist with the efficient distribution of air and gases, reducing the likelihood of leaks and system failures.
4. Marine Environments The corrosion resistance of 4% stainless steel makes it an ideal choice for maritime applications, where exposure to saltwater can degrade other materials. The elbows are used in piping systems aboard ships, for cooling systems, and in various structural applications.
Advantages of Using 4% Stainless Steel 90 Degree Elbows
1. Corrosion Resistance The primary benefit of using stainless steel is its resistance to rust and corrosion. This property is especially important in environments exposed to moisture and chemicals.
2. Durability and Longevity Stainless steel is known for its strength and ability to withstand high pressures and temperatures. As a result, 90-degree elbows made from 4% stainless steel tend to have a longer lifespan compared to fittings made from other materials.
3. Low Maintenance Due to its corrosion resistance, stainless steel fittings require less maintenance. This characteristic is particularly valuable in industrial applications where downtime can be costly.
